Predictive Nearest-Level Control Algorithm for Modular Multilevel Converters With Reduced Harmonic Distortion
Abstract
Owing to the low number of submodules (SMs) in modular multilevel converters (MMCs), especially in medium-voltage applications, the output current and voltage generated by conventional nearest-level control (NLC) methods contain evident distortions.
